Biochem/physiol Actions
Recognizes the full length 32 kDa caspase-3 protein. Highly specific to caspase-3 and shows no cross-reaction with other caspase family members. Caspase-3 is ubiquitously expressed and like other caspases is synthesized as an inactive proenzyme. Upon activation, caspase-3 is cleaved generating two smaller subunits of 17 kDa and 12 kDa. Caspase-3 is one of the most extensively studied enzyme in apoptosis. Activation of caspase-3 occurs in response to a variety of apoptotic inducers.
